Email: sabrangind@gmail.com
Tag: speedy trial
Liberty on Hold: Delays turn the promise of justice into punishment
“The right to a speedy trial, now firmly entrenched in our constitutional jurisprudence under Article 21 of the Constitution of India, is not an abstract or illusory safeguard. It is a vital facet of the right to personal liberty and cannot be whittled down merely because the case arises under a special statute.”
CJP Team -